附录一 Growth and Survival—The Complete Toolkit
As tumors progress to a more aggressive state, they acquire multiple genetic alterations, some that have little functional impact and others that are essential for the continued growth and survival of the tumor cells. Schlabach et al. and Silva et al. have developed a functional genomics strategy that will allow, at a genome-wide level, systematic identification of genes required for cell growth and survival. Cell lines derived from human mammary and colorectal cancers and normal mammary tissue showed a similar pattern of so-called "essential" genes, with many residing within functional pathways known to be critical for fundamental cellular processes such as cell cycle and translational control. Importantly, however, additional genes were identified as being essential for the growth of specific cell lines. This functional genomics strategy complements the cancer genome sequencing approaches that have shown recent success and could set the stage for high-throughput discovery of cancer drugs.
Schlabach MR, Luo J, Solimini NL, Hu G, Xu Q, Li MZ, Zhao Z, Smogorzewska A, Sowa ME, Ang XL, Westbrook TF, Liang AC, Chang K, Hackett JA, Harper JW, Hannon GJ, Elledge SJ. 2008. Cancer proliferation gene discovery through functional genomics. Science. 2008 Feb 1;319(5863):620-4.
Silva JM, Marran K, Parker JS, Silva J, Golding M, Schlabach MR, Elledge SJ, Hannon GJ, Chang K. 2008. Profiling essential genes in human mammary cells by multiplex RNAi screening. Science. 2008 Feb 1;319(5863):617-20. |
